1. mbreese ◴[] No.43652676[source]
Is a public service announcement. If you’re using test@gmail.com to actually test something, you should probably be using test@example.com. Not everyone knows that example.com exists for these purposes.

That is of course unless you really intend to send an email to someone at test@gmail.com.
